5 Trends Influencing Real Estate in the Millennial Era
Millennials are redefining the real estate landscape, fueling a surge in innovative trends. First among these is the explosion of co-living spaces, addressing the expectations of this generation that values community. Another noticeable trend is the preference for urban living, with Millennials pulled to bustling neighborhoods that offer a blend of convenience.
The adoption of smart home systems is also significantly transforming the real estate experience for Millennials. From virtual tours to mobile platforms for browsing properties, technology is enhancing the entire process.
Millennials are also placing a high value on eco-friendliness, demanding homes that are green. This trend is motivating developers to create more eco-conscious buildings.
Lastly, Millennials are shifting the traditional real estate model by embracing renting over traditional homes. This flexibility is drawing them to metropolitan regions that offer a wide range of rental options.
